import React, { useEffect, useState } from "react"; import dataImage1 from "../../assets/images/data-table-user-1.png"; import usersService from "../../services/UsersService"; import LoadingSpinner from "../Spinners/LoadingSpinner"; export default function HomeActivities({ className }) { const [recentActivitiesData, setRecentActivitiesData] = useState({ loading: false, status: false, msg: "", data: null, }); const _apiCall = new usersService(); const getRecentActivities = async () => { setRecentActivitiesData((prev) => ({ ...prev, loading: true })); let res; try { res = await _apiCall.getRecentActivities(null); res = res.data; if (res?.internal_return >= 0) { setRecentActivitiesData((prev) => ({ ...prev, loading: false, status: true, data: res.result_list, })); } else { setRecentActivitiesData((prev) => ({ ...prev, loading: false, status: false, msg: "Something went wrong", })); } } catch (error) { setRecentActivitiesData((prev) => ({ ...prev, loading: false, status: false, msg: "Unable to see this", })); throw new Error(`Unable to see this because: ${error}`); } }; useEffect(() => { getRecentActivities(); }, []); console.log(recentActivitiesData); return (
| */} {/* All Product*/} {/* | */} {/*. | */} {/**/} {/* | */} {/* |
|
|
|||
|
{/*
{item.title ? item.title : "Title"}{item.description ? item.description : ""} |
{item.added ? addedDate : ""}
|